Millimeter-Wave Applications Based on Gap Waveguides Technology

Prof. Ahmed Kishk, Electrical and Computer Engineering, Concordia University, Montreal, Canada

Mar 10, 12:00 - 13:00

B9 L2 H2 LH2

gap waveguide electromagnetic bandgap

Traditional guiding structures and microwave packaging have limitations regarding losses or physical realization. Therefore, there is a need for efficient millimeter-wave guiding structures that overcome such limitations. Gap waveguide technology is found to overcome such limitations at millimeter-wave bands. Interest in such technology is increasing.
